- Five local men are being questioned for allegedly hacking the websites of Singapore's president and prime minister, police said Tuesday, amid a rash of cyber attacks in the city-state. Read more here.
- A Singaporean man charged on Tuesday with hacking the Ang Mo Kio town council website in October was ordered remanded to the Institute of Mental Health (IMH) for psychiatric evaluation for up to two weeks. Find out more here.
